Bare Tube Bundle Shell & Tube Water to Oil Cooling

The B/SB Series is very versatile in its ability to accommodate multiple application requirements. 700 and 1000 sizes feature 3/8” tube option for less pressure drop. ¼” tube offers greater surface area, and multiple baffle spacing options to optimize heat transfer.

The B series is a non-ferrous, Brass construction, which makes it ideal for water to water, including sea water cooling applications.

The SB series is competitively priced steel construction version of the B series, and mainly used for standard hydraulic applications.

Industrial Air Cooled Copper Tube/Aluminum Fins

The Industrial AOVH Series is our high performance series coolers that offer high heat rejection and low pressure drops for high flow applications.   The series features an AC fan drive, and is available with an optional pressure internal pressure bypass.  Cabinet louvers allow the user to regulate the direction of heated exhaust air.  The utilization of High-Low Turbulator design yields high flow capacity with low flow pressure. This versatile design allows for a one or two pass configuration.

Industrial Air Cooled Brazed Aluminum Coolers

BOL/BOLR Series provides outstanding heat dissipation for extreme heat loads in a rugged, lightweight and compact design.  Available with AC or hydraulic fan motors, all feature proven brazed aluminum bar and plate core technology engineered with an aggressive turbulator that produces ultra-high heat transfer.  TTP’s exclusive TBar extruded tube cores are also available for high viscosity oil application to reduce pressure drop.  Available with two bypass options, either pressure bypass or temperature/pressure bypass.  The internal bypass option eliminates extra piping reducing costs, and helps the cooler come out of bypass faster in cold start applications.
